551.38 mi Straight Distance
645.33 mi Driving Distance
12 hours 12 mins Estimated Driving Time
The straight distance between Concordia (Northern Cape) and Excelsior (Free State) is 551.38 mi, but the driving distance is 645.33 mi.
It takes to go from Concordia to Excelsior.
Driving directions from Concordia to Excelsior
Straight distance: 887.17 km. Route distance: 1,038.34 km
Latitude: -29.5398 // Longitude: 17.9433

Forecast: Clear sky
Temperature: 21.6°
Humidity: 43%
Current time: 12:00 AM
Sunrise: 04:36 AM
Sunset: 05:25 PM
Latitude: -28.9394 // Longitude: 27.0653

Forecast: Clear sky
Temperature: 21.1°
Humidity: 48%
Current time: 12:00 AM
Sunrise: 04:00 AM
Sunset: 04:48 PM